概述:大多数钱包应用可在应用商店下载,如苹果App Store或Google Play。以TP钱包为例,本文从冷钱包、先进技术架构、专家透析、高效市场支付应用、合约导入与高效交易处理系统六个维度进行综合分析与实践建议。

1. 冷钱包(Cold Wallet)
- 定位与价值:冷钱包负责离线私钥管理,是对抗网络攻击与托管风险的最后防线。适用于大额或长期持有资产。
- 实践要点:支持离线签名、二维码或USB/硬件密钥交互、分层确定性密钥(BIP32/BIP44)与多重签名方案。硬件兼容性与导入/导出标准(如PKCS#8, mnemonic)至关重要。
2. 先进技术架构

- 模块化与分层:客户端与签名层、网络层、存储层、合约解析层分离,便于安全审计与功能扩展。
- 微服务与边缘部署:后端采用微服务与容器化,支持弹性伸缩;前端使用轻量SDK与WebAssembly模块以提高移植性。
- 加密与密钥管理:采用可信执行环境(TEE)、硬件安全模块(HSM)与端到端加密,增加密钥使用的最小权限原则。
3. 专家透析(安全与合规)
- 审计与威胁建模:代码审计、形式化验证(对关键合约进行符号执行/模糊测试)与定期渗透测试是必要流程。
- 隐私与合规:数据最小化、合规日志与支持可选的链上隐私方案(如zk)可降低合规风险。
4. 高效能市场支付应用
- 低延迟与高可用:采用本地缓存、离线支付队列与异步确认提示,提升用户体验;对接多链与Layer2以降低手续费与提升吞吐。
- UX与风控:支付路径智能路由、动态费率提示、滑点/失败回滚机制与反欺诈监测共同保障市场支付场景。
5. 合约导入与互操作
- 导入流程:支持ABI/字节码导入、源码验证、合约校验与自动生成UI交互表单,降低用户误操作风险。
- 安全提示:合约权限审查、可升级代理识别与危险行为告警(如授权无限期批准)是用户保护关键。
6. 高效交易处理系统
- 批量处理与Gas优化:批量打包、交易聚合、部分签名与智能nonce管理减少链上成本与冲突重试。
- 交易确认策略:结合乐观确认、交易替换(replace-by-fee)与回滚策略,提供可预测的支付体验。
- 中继与Paymaster:引入交易代付/中继服务可提升新用户体验并支持元交易(meta-transactions)。
结论与建议:TP钱包类应用应在用户便捷性与安全保障间寻求平衡。推荐路线包括:建立硬件冷钱包支持与安全导入导出标准;采用模块化架构并结合TEE/HSM;对合约导入与交易流程实施严格自动化审计与风险提示;扩展Layer2与中继策略以提升支付效率。最后,持续的第三方安全审计与透明度报告是建立用户信任的长期机制。
评论
AlexChen
内容很全面,特别是合约导入的风险提示部分,很实用。
小黑猫
关于冷钱包和TEE的结合能不能举个硬件实现的例子?
Maya
建议再补充一下跨链交易的安全考量,不过总体很专业。
李青云
交易聚合和中继服务确实是提高体验的关键,实践中注意合规性。
Dev_王
喜欢模块化架构的建议,对工程落地指导性强。